On a public holiday, families flocked to a robot 'carnival' at an R&D hub on the outskirts of Shanghai, where more than 100 companies showcased humanoid robots, robotic dogs, and other machines, reflecting China's strategic push to embed artificial intelligence into physical systems—a vision known as embodied AI that is central to the country's latest five-year plan.

At a bustling R&D center on the outskirts of Shanghai, an 11-year-old boy watched his new mini robotic dog attempt a handstand. The toy was a gift from his mother, purchased at a robot 'carnival' held by the hub, which houses more than 100 companies researching, developing, and manufacturing robotic technologies. The event, described by MIT Technology Review reporter You Xiaoying, drew curious families eager to see the latest in Chinese robotics.

Children and parents alike engaged with a variety of machines: two staffers taught youngsters how to make a quadrupedal robot walk up stairs, while a remote-controlled battle between two robots firing water beads ended in a draw. Nearby, a humanoid robot from DexForce made coffee, and another pair of robotic arms attempted to fold a basket of T-shirts. "These machines can free people from physical work and mundane chores," said Yang Duan, a product manager at DexForce.

The carnival is a small window into China's broader strategy. The country's latest five-year plan explicitly includes embodied AI—embedding intelligence into physical systems—as a key facet. According to Forbes, nearly 90% of the more than 13,000 two-armed, two-legged robots delivered globally last year were made in China. Chinese companies like Unitree, Fourier Intelligence, and DexForce have become world leaders in humanoid production, though most models remain in early-stage deployment or demonstration.

While the event celebrated technological progress, it also highlighted the gap between showcase and widespread adoption. Many robots on display were still performing simple, controlled tasks, and the folding T-shirt robot struggled to complete its job. Observers note that cost, reliability, and safety remain significant hurdles before humanoids enter homes and factories at scale.

Critics also caution that the rapid push for humanoids could lead to job displacement, particularly in manufacturing and logistics, where China's workforce is already under pressure. Privacy advocates have raised concerns about the potential use of humanoid robots for surveillance, given the country's expansive social credit system. Meanwhile, Western governments are watching China's robotics ascent with unease, citing national security risks and the need for export controls on advanced AI hardware.

DexForce's Yang Duan acknowledged the long road ahead: "We are still in the early stages. The real challenge is making these robots reliable and affordable for everyday use." For now, the carnival served as a public relations exercise, building excitement and acceptance for a future where robots are part of daily life.

Background

China's robotics push is part of a broader national strategy to lead in artificial intelligence. The concept of embodied AI—embedding intelligence into physical systems—was formally included in the 2026-2030 Five-Year Plan, signaling top-down support. Over the past decade, Chinese companies have moved from industrial robots to humanoids, with firms like Unitree, Fourier Intelligence, and DexForce gaining international recognition. However, most humanoids remain in pilot phases, limited by cost, battery life, and real-world reliability. The Shanghai carnival, hosted by a consolidated R&D center, represents a government-backed effort to showcase progress and cultivate consumer interest.

Key Perspectives

[Chinese government and industry]: They view humanoids as a strategic industry that can boost productivity, address an aging population, and secure technological sovereignty. Events like the carnival are designed to build public enthusiasm and attract investment. [Critics and skeptics]: Labor unions and economists warn that widespread automation could displace millions of workers without adequate retraining programs. Privacy advocates fear that humanoid robots, connected to cloud systems, could be used for surveillance. Safety experts point to the risk of malfunctions in uncontrolled environments. [Western competitors and policymakers]: U.S. and European officials are concerned about China's head start in humanoid manufacturing and potential dual-use applications. Calls for export controls on AI chips and robotics components are growing, though some argue that collaboration could accelerate innovation.
